Proposed ‘Stunner’ Trade Sends Cowboys a Speedy $81 Million Receiver

One thing that is clear is the Dallas Cowboys will be making more moves at wide receiver before the offseason concludes. The Cowboys are likely to select a wideout in the upcoming NFL draft, but the team could also explore adding a veteran via trade.

Bleacher Report’s Alex Ballentine outlined a few potential trade proposals that would allow the Cowboys to improve their offense. One potential “stunner” deal has the Cowboys landing Texans playmaker Brandin Cooks in exchange for a third-round pick (No. 88) in April’s draft. Houston is in rebuild mode as the Cowboys look to replace Amari Cooper who became a cap casualty via trade earlier this offseason.

“This trade would be a stunner given what the Cowboys have done with their receivers this offseason,” Ballentine wrote on March 30, 2022. “They traded away Amari Cooper for next to nothing and invested heavily in Michael Gallup. However, this deal would again give Dallas one of the best receiving trios in the league.
